I have been to this store multiple times. The fresh food (vegetables, diary and meat) is well maintained. Food is usually is in good shape or better.

There natural foods section (excluding organic vegetables that is in another section) is small compared to the size of this store, but it has a lot of popular items...non-diary milks, energy/snack bars, cereals (quite a bit), faux-meats, gluten free items here and there, chocolates, baking supplies like flours, organic beans, soups, sauces, a handful of organic products (there is more throughout the store) and more. Pricing can be fair or a little expensive (50 cents to $2-3). Everything else in the store is similarly priced to most nearby Stop and Shops.

In terms of store design, it's big. Lots of aisle, but the lighting is a bit too dim and too yellow in my opinion (outside of the meat areas).

Customer service from the staff is good too. If you need something, they will help you quick. The employees I have meet, they are well versed on the aisle contents.
